Understanding the Core Mechanics of Plinko
At its heart, Plinko is a game of chance. A virtual ball is dropped from the top of a pyramid-shaped grid. As the ball descends, it bounces off pegs, randomly landing in one of the prize slots at the bottom. The value of the slot determines the payout received. The gameplay is exceptionally straightforward, requiring no prior skill or experience, making it ideal for casual gamers.
However, beneath its simplicity lies a layer of strategic depth. Players are given control over several key parameters that can significantly influence their odds and potential returns. These include risk level (low, normal, and high) and the number of lines played. Understanding how these settings interact is crucial for maximizing the enjoyment and potential profitability of the game.

Understanding the RTP and House Edge
One of the most appealing aspects of BGaming’s Plinko is its extraordinarily high Return to Player (RTP) of 99%. This signifies that, on average, players can expect to recover 99% of their total wagers over the long term. This is significantly higher than the average RTP found in many other casino games. However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ical calculation based on millions of simulations and does not guarantee individual outcomes.
The implied house edge in Plinko is therefore only 1%, an incredibly low margin for a casino game. This makes Plinko a particularly attractive option for players who are looking for a game with favorable odds. It’s important to note though, that luck still plays a significant role, and even with a low house edge, losses are always possible.
